just finished my engine rebuild and wondering where my cam should set in relation to my crank. i have my cam at TDC, but the crank will only go about 8 degrees before or after and not right on. i think this is affecting the car really bad, cuz it's really slow til about 3 k, then just drops like some crazy vtec.

do i need to get an adjustable cam gear, if so where can i get one cheap. thanks

how are you aligning the cam?

the lines that run along the head's edge are for 1.5l

for 1.6 you want the up marking about 11 o'clock position, look straight at the bottom and you'll see another line which should line up w/ the mark on the head/block.

EDIT EDIT EDIT

Im seeing conflicting facts. My manual @ home says the way i described above. The online manual on our forms describes the up mark and the left/right lines should line up w/ the head.

Some1 chime in please
